Transaction 330378f84ebafec8c493ff2ec93e2b44622484ddd8885c8e889bcd9ca8f26530
1 Input
1 Output
-
330378f84ebafec8c493ff2ec93e2b44622484ddd8885c8e889bcd9ca8f26530:0
- value
- 86947552
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b3f8e2f42f1828a2d98e02c70a63908b6bc099ff O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HQc7H6X31t1TahMwMjtgfPPHoX231sRpF